Answer:

Graph which have Focus ( 0 , 2) and Vertex = ( 0 , 0 ).

Step-by-step explanation:

Given : x² =8 y.

To find : Which graph represents the equation .

Solution : We have given that

x² =8 y.

On dividing both sides by 8

y = [tex]\frac{x^{2}}{8}[/tex].

Vertex form of parabola y = a (x-h)² + k

Where, ( h ,k )  is vertex

h = 0  and  k = 0

Vertex = ( 0 , 0 ).

a = [tex]\frac{1}{8}[/tex].

Focus ( h , k + p).

p =  [tex]\frac{1}{4a}[/tex].

p =  [tex]\frac{8}{4}[/tex].

p = 2

Then , Focus ( 0 , 2).

Therefore, Graph which have Focus ( 0 , 2) and Vertex = ( 0 , 0 ).
